Training and Boundaries

Volunteer roles are education-focused, beginner-aware, and matched to comfort level.

What Weedstraindb Provides

  • Role guidance before events or tasks
  • Beginner-friendly education materials
  • Clear expectations for public-facing support
  • Options for behind-the-scenes help

What Volunteers Should Avoid

  • Giving medical, legal, or dosing advice
  • Pressuring anyone toward a product or choice
  • Creating a smoke-session or party environment
  • Representing personal opinions as official guidance
